过表达的长链非编码RNA CDKN2B-AS1是肝癌的独立预后因素,并促进其增殖。

Overexpressed lncRNA CDKN2B-AS1 is an independent prognostic factor for liver cancer and promotes its proliferation.

Abstract

PURPOSE

To study the expression of long non-coding RNA (lncRNA) CDKN2B-AS1 in the liver tissue of patients with liver cancer and its effect on the proliferation of liver cancer cell line QGY-7703.

METHODS

The expression of differentially expressed genes in liver cancer tissues and normal liver tissues was analyzed by bioinformatics. The expressions of differentially expressed genes in clinical samples were analyzed by quantitative real-time polymerase chain reaction (qRT-PCR) to analyze whether there is a significant difference of CDKN2B-AS1 expression in clinical features of patients with liver cancer. The clinical data were analyzed to find out the correlation between the expressions of differentially expressed genes and the overall survival, tumor size and TNM staging. The Gene Set Enrichment Analysis (GSEA) enrichment analysis was used to predict the function of CDKN2B-AS1. The cell proliferation was measured by cell counting kit-8 (CCK-8) assay. Cell cycle was measured by flow cytometry. Expressions of proteins were detected by Western blotting.

RESULTS

The expression of CDKN2B-AS1 in liver cancer was significantly higher compared to normal tissues. The results of qRT-PCR were consistent with the results of the Cancer Genome Atlas (TGCA). The data of CDKN2B-AS1 showed that the expression of CDKN2B-AS1 was associated with the total survival, tumor size and TNM staging. GSEA results showed that genes are enriched in cell cycle sets and others. Compared with the control, the proliferation of QGY-7703 cells overexpressing CDKN2B-AS1 was significantly increased (p<0.001). Western blotting results showed that the expressions of CDK2 and CDK4 were up-regulated and the expression of P16 was decreased after CDKN2B-AS1 was overexpressed.

CONCLUSIONS

LncRNA CDKN2B-AS1 was highly expressed in liver cancer, and its expression was positively correlated with the overall survival, tumor size and TNM stage. LncRNA CDKN2B-AS1 promoted the proliferation and expression of liver cancer cells.

摘要

目的

研究长链非编码RNA(lncRNA)CDKN2B-AS1在肝癌患者肝组织中的表达及其对肝癌细胞系QGY-7703增殖的影响。

方法

通过生物信息学分析肝癌组织和正常肝组织中差异表达基因的表达情况。采用定量实时聚合酶链反应(qRT-PCR)分析临床样本中差异表达基因的表达,以分析CDKN2B-AS1在肝癌患者临床特征中的表达是否存在显著差异。分析临床数据以找出差异表达基因的表达与总生存期、肿瘤大小和TNM分期之间的相关性。使用基因集富集分析(GSEA)富集分析来预测CDKN2B-AS1的功能。通过细胞计数试剂盒-8(CCK-8)法检测细胞增殖。通过流式细胞术检测细胞周期。通过蛋白质印迹法检测蛋白质表达。

结果

与正常组织相比,CDKN2B-AS1在肝癌中的表达显著更高。qRT-PCR结果与癌症基因组图谱(TGCA)的结果一致。CDKN2B-AS1的数据表明,CDKN2B-AS1的表达与总生存期、肿瘤大小和TNM分期相关。GSEA结果表明基因在细胞周期集等中富集。与对照相比,过表达CDKN2B-AS1的QGY-7703细胞的增殖显著增加(p<0.001)。蛋白质印迹结果表明,过表达CDKN2B-AS1后,CDK2和CDK4的表达上调,P16的表达降低。

结论

LncRNA CDKN2B-AS1在肝癌中高表达,其表达与总生存期、肿瘤大小和TNM分期呈正相关。LncRNA CDKN2B-AS1促进肝癌细胞的增殖和表达。
